Thank you all so much for your prayers...I have an update, and it is mostly good news!

My uncle is still in UCSF. We spent probably half of the time we weren't sleeping this holiday at the hospital in ICU or driving the hour there or back. His daughter was all by herself for most of the time, and he pretty much needed someone in the room at all times (once he was more conscious, he was very aware of the catheter/breathing tube/IV and the discomfort that they were causing, but not aware enough to know that they had to stay in. So he would attempt, constantly, to pull them out unless he was restrained. The restraints that they put him in, though, were bruising the heck out of his wrists and arms, so it was better if someone was in the room to hold his hand and calm him down. We were able to take shifts so his daughter could go nap, eat, shower, etc, which was great, but meant we spent a lot of time at the hospital. Totally worth it to be there for her, though, and we had a couple of very tender moments with him and with her.

On Friday he was totally unconscious and on a respirator after being medivac'd to UCSF, but on Saturday he woke up, which was an awesome Christmas present. He still wasn't talking or responding consistently to commands...but he got to be off of the respirator. Sunday, he was talking in full sentences, but without a filter (at one point, he looked squarely at Sarah while his nurse was in the room, and said "Sarah, do you think (male nurse's name) is gay?"). He was definitely getting his sharpness back, though...a speech pathologist game in to do a swallow test, and was talking to him like he was confused - not her fault, he totally was a lot of the time - and said "I'm a doctor who looks at your talking and swallowing"...and he looked her in the eye and said "You're a speech pathologist named (name he read off of her nametag)". Today he moved out of ICU and onto the regular floor, and is eating again and continuing to talk. So that's all good. Apparently his anti-seizure medications were really hard for him to swallow (they were large and his mouth was dry from the chemo), so he and his doctor decided to wean him off of them...which was clearly the wrong decision. But he's back on them and on the mend.

NOW the good, other than the fact that he's recovering well. They did a CT scan to check for damage in his brain from the seizure, and those scans showed a TON of improvement in the size of the tumor. Like, remarkable improvement for one round of chemo. Where there were obscured ventricles before, they were totally visible. Where there was evidence of the tumor putting pressure on his brain, the brain was back in place. He'll always have some damage, and he'll probably not get a whole ton more years, but the responsiveness he had to the chemo and radiation is a GREAT sign. And there didn't appear to be any actual damage from the seizure once they got it controlled. So that part is simply phenomenal, even though it was one heck of a weekend. It looks like he'll be released Wednesday-ish.

So thank you all very much...despite the scary circumstances, it looks like things are looking up for his health in general.
